.TH "TESTING/LIN/sppt03.f" 3 "Version 3.12.0" "LAPACK" \" -*- nroff -*- .ad l .nh .SH NAME TESTING/LIN/sppt03.f .SH SYNOPSIS .br .PP .SS "Functions/Subroutines" .in +1c .ti -1c .RI "subroutine \fBsppt03\fP (uplo, n, a, ainv, work, ldwork, rwork, rcond, resid)" .br .RI "\fBSPPT03\fP " .in -1c .SH "Function/Subroutine Documentation" .PP .SS "subroutine sppt03 (character uplo, integer n, real, dimension( * ) a, real, dimension( * ) ainv, real, dimension( ldwork, * ) work, integer ldwork, real, dimension( * ) rwork, real rcond, real resid)" .PP \fBSPPT03\fP .PP \fBPurpose:\fP .RS 4 .PP .nf SPPT03 computes the residual for a symmetric packed matrix times its inverse: norm( I - A*AINV ) / ( N * norm(A) * norm(AINV) * EPS ), where EPS is the machine epsilon\&. .fi .PP .RE .PP \fBParameters\fP .RS 4 \fIUPLO\fP .PP .nf UPLO is CHARACTER*1 Specifies whether the upper or lower triangular part of the symmetric matrix A is stored: = 'U': Upper triangular = 'L': Lower triangular .fi .PP .br \fIN\fP .PP .nf N is INTEGER The number of rows and columns of the matrix A\&. N >= 0\&. .fi .PP .br \fIA\fP .PP .nf A is REAL array, dimension (N*(N+1)/2) The original symmetric matrix A, stored as a packed triangular matrix\&. .fi .PP .br \fIAINV\fP .PP .nf AINV is REAL array, dimension (N*(N+1)/2) The (symmetric) inverse of the matrix A, stored as a packed triangular matrix\&. .fi .PP .br \fIWORK\fP .PP .nf WORK is REAL array, dimension (LDWORK,N) .fi .PP .br \fILDWORK\fP .PP .nf LDWORK is INTEGER The leading dimension of the array WORK\&. LDWORK >= max(1,N)\&. .fi .PP .br \fIRWORK\fP .PP .nf RWORK is REAL array, dimension (N) .fi .PP .br \fIRCOND\fP .PP .nf RCOND is REAL The reciprocal of the condition number of A, computed as ( 1/norm(A) ) / norm(AINV)\&. .fi .PP .br \fIRESID\fP .PP .nf RESID is REAL norm(I - A*AINV) / ( N * norm(A) * norm(AINV) * EPS ) .fi .PP .RE .PP \fBAuthor\fP .RS 4 Univ\&. of Tennessee .PP Univ\&. of California Berkeley .PP Univ\&. of Colorado Denver .PP NAG Ltd\&. .RE .PP .PP Definition at line \fB108\fP of file \fBsppt03\&.f\fP\&. .SH "Author" .PP Generated automatically by Doxygen for LAPACK from the source code\&.
